Output 21ef5fdb9332743c3bf990b93b6e5343465286098dd4f8f7768134e50f378f1a:1

value
517446
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fdb91ef3da61cd90a3e7fa1b7c876779062a9a1e678976cc0aef0b806edfb9c9
address
bc1plku3au76v8xepgl8lgdhepm80yrz4xs7v7yhdnq2au9cqmklh8ys6lw4x8
transaction
21ef5fdb9332743c3bf990b93b6e5343465286098dd4f8f7768134e50f378f1a
spent
true